Output c23064a9549ad1b0dbdff6a5beff7b5f62d2b6eb0cfdf78684a01b097c821780:4

value
73463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ea3daad58d0da675d82e27a36cc443128b30e1c OP_EQUAL
address
3MzEDvKFyg6jcHq5hDWvQ83bVR2kr1u6FK
transaction
c23064a9549ad1b0dbdff6a5beff7b5f62d2b6eb0cfdf78684a01b097c821780
confirmations
268540
spent
true